Hyundai Creta: Air Conditioning System / Components and components location

Component Location Index
[Engine Room]

1. Ambient temperature Sensor
2. Condenser
3. Compressor
4. Discharge Hose
5. Service Port (High Pressure)
6. Suction & Liquid Tube Assembly
7. Service Port (Low Pressure)
8. Expansion Valve

[Interior]

1. Photo Sensor
2. Heater & Blower Unit
3. Evaporator Temperature Sensor
4. Heater & A/C Control Unit (Manual)
5. Heater & A/C Control Unit (DATC)
